Output 3bbab928ac353c653d02448971ed8c9688b4b7f672483b12e3577854428c6157:80

value
3014968
script pubkey
OP_0 OP_PUSHBYTES_32 dd68e083316dad970104b2cdbebc723f9dd7c0684f7fbe581a0a9d047568d5ea
address
bc1qm45wpqe3dkkewqgyktxma0rj87wa0srgfalmukq6p2wsgatg6h4qhxjgsj
transaction
3bbab928ac353c653d02448971ed8c9688b4b7f672483b12e3577854428c6157
spent
true